How to Get Started with 18 Shortcuts Automation for Seamless Media Management

One of the primary reasons users search for 18 shortcuts automation is to handle media more efficiently. If you find yourself manually saving files, renaming them, and moving them to secure folders, you are working harder than you should. Modern automation allows you to trigger a sequence that detects a link in your clipboard, identifies the media type, and stores it exactly where it needs to be.

To start with 18 shortcuts automation, you first need to ensure your device's settings allow for "Untrusted Shortcuts" (if you are downloading them from community repositories) or that you have the latest OS updates to support advanced scripting. The core of these automations usually involves fetching the contents of a URL and using regex (regular expressions) to find the direct download link for a video or image. This is a game-changer for those who need to archive content quickly without leaving their browser.



Setting Up Your First Automation Workflow

Open the Shortcuts App: This is the hub for all your 18 shortcuts automation activities.Create a New Action: Start with a "Get Clipboard" or "Share Sheet" trigger.Define the Logic: Add actions like "Get Contents of URL" and "Save to Photo Album."Test and Refine: Run the shortcut to ensure it handles errors gracefully, such as when a link is broken or a site is behind a login wall.

Troubleshooting Common Issues in Your 18 Shortcuts Automation Setup

Even the most well-designed 18 shortcuts automation can occasionally run into hurdles. The most common issue is a "URL Fetch Error," which usually happens when a website changes its structure or adds bot protection. Because these automations rely on the specific HTML layout of a site, any update to the platform can break the "scraping" logic of the shortcut.

Another frequent problem with 18 shortcuts automation is memory management. If you are trying to automate the download of high-definition 4K videos, the device's RAM may struggle to process the data, leading to a "Shortcuts Quit Unexpectedly" message. To fix this, it is often better to break one large 18 shortcuts automation into several smaller, linked shortcuts that pass data to one another sequentially.



Tips for Maintaining High-Performance Shortcuts

Keep Scripts Simple: Avoid overly complex loops that can drain battery life.Update Regularly: Check the community forums where you found your 18 shortcuts automation for updated versions.Use Global Variables: This allows different shortcuts to share data without having to re-fetch information from the internet.

Exploring the Legitimacy and Safety of Automation Tools

A common question among those discovering 18 shortcuts automation is whether these tools are safe to use. Since many of these shortcuts are community-created, it is vital to exercise caution. A "shortcut" is essentially a piece of code, and like any code, it can be written to perform malicious actions, such as sending your clipboard data to a third-party server.

To stay safe while using 18 shortcuts automation, always inspect the actions within a shortcut before running it for the first time. Look for any "URL" actions that point to unfamiliar domains or "Send Message" actions that might be trying to export your data. The beauty of the Shortcuts app is its transparency; you can see every single step the automation takes before you hit the "play" button. Stick to reputable sources and community-verified versions of 18 shortcuts automation to ensure your data remains your own.
